18.3 Psychosocial and Sociological Determinants of Oral Health
Key Takeaways
- Oral disease follows a social gradient operating across the whole population, so measures aimed only at the most deprived reduce inequality less than population-wide measures.
- The inverse care law describes how the availability of good care varies inversely with the need of the population served.
- Teach-back asks the patient to explain the plan in their own words as a check on the clinician's explanation, and is central to valid consent where health literacy is limited.
- The common risk factor approach recognises that sugar, tobacco, alcohol and stress drive both oral and major non-communicable diseases.
- Oral health-related quality of life measures such as OHIP-14 capture the social and psychological impact that clinical indices miss.
The Social Gradient
Oral disease in the UK is not evenly distributed. It follows a social gradient: at every step down the socioeconomic scale, caries experience, periodontal disease, tooth loss and oral cancer incidence rise. This is not a phenomenon confined to the most deprived; it operates across the whole population, which is why interventions aimed only at the very poorest reduce inequality less than population-wide measures.
Dahlgren and Whitehead's rainbow model describes layers of influence:
- Fixed individual factors — age, sex, genetic constitution
- Individual lifestyle factors — diet, smoking, oral hygiene
- Social and community networks — family, peers, social support
- Living and working conditions — housing, education, employment, access to care
- General socioeconomic, cultural and environmental conditions
Most dental advice targets layer two only, which is why it has limited effect on inequality.
The Inverse Care Law and Access
Tudor Hart's inverse care law states that the availability of good medical care tends to vary inversely with the need of the population served. In UK dentistry this appears as fewer NHS practices accepting new patients in deprived areas, longer travel distances, and higher rates of emergency-only attendance.
Barriers to access operate at several levels:
| Barrier | Examples |
|---|---|
| Financial | NHS charge bands, loss of earnings from time off work, travel cost |
| Structural | Practice opening hours, waiting lists, physical accessibility, distance |
| Cultural and linguistic | Language, interpreter availability, health beliefs, previous experience of discrimination |
| Psychological | Dental anxiety, shame about the state of the mouth, fear of being judged |
| Informational | Not knowing entitlement to free NHS treatment, not knowing how to register |
Certain groups face compounded barriers: people experiencing homelessness, people in prison, refugees and asylum seekers, people with severe mental illness, people with learning disabilities, older people in residential care, and Gypsy, Roma and Traveller communities.
Health Literacy
Health literacy is the capacity to obtain, process and understand basic health information well enough to make appropriate decisions. Limited health literacy is common and is not the same as low intelligence or low education in an unrelated field.
Practical responses:
- Use plain language and avoid unexplained terms such as "calculus", "prophylaxis" or "occlusal".
- Use the teach-back method: ask the patient to explain the plan back in their own words, framed as a check on your own explanation rather than a test of them.
- Support verbal information with written or visual material at an accessible reading level.
- Remember that consent obtained from a patient who did not understand the explanation is not valid consent, which links health literacy directly to the legal material in the consent chapter.
The Common Risk Factor Approach
Sheiham and Watt's common risk factor approach is the organising principle of modern dental public health. Oral diseases share risk factors with the major non-communicable diseases:
| Shared risk factor | Oral outcome | Systemic outcome |
|---|---|---|
| Diet high in free sugars | Dental caries | Obesity, type 2 diabetes |
| Tobacco | Periodontitis, oral cancer, implant failure | Lung cancer, cardiovascular disease, COPD |
| Alcohol | Oral cancer, erosion, trauma | Liver disease, cardiovascular disease |
| Stress | Bruxism, necrotising gingivitis, periodontitis | Cardiovascular disease, mental illness |
| Poor hygiene and control of plaque | Caries, periodontitis | Aspiration pneumonia in dependent adults |
The practical consequence is that oral health improvement should be integrated with wider health policy — sugar reduction, tobacco control, alcohol policy — rather than delivered as isolated dental messages.
Psychological Impact of Oral Disease
Oral disease affects far more than function. Tooth loss, visible caries and halitosis affect self-esteem, employability, social participation and mental health, which is why oral health-related quality of life measures such as OHIP-14 exist alongside clinical indices. A clinically small anterior restoration can matter more to a patient than a technically demanding posterior one, and treatment planning that ignores this is not genuinely patient-centred.
Exam link. A question describing a deprived community with high caries rates and poor attendance is testing whether you recognise that individual oral hygiene instruction alone will not close the gap. The expected answer involves population-level measures such as water fluoridation, supervised toothbrushing programmes and targeted outreach, combined with addressing access barriers.
Applying the Determinants in the Surgery
The examinable translation is that social circumstances change clinical decisions. A patient who cannot reliably attend because of shift work or caring responsibilities may be better served by a durable, low-maintenance restoration than by an ideal but demanding plan. A patient with limited health literacy needs written information at an appropriate reading level, teach-back to confirm understanding, and demonstration rather than description. A patient in financial hardship needs the NHS charge bands and exemptions explained honestly, because unexplained cost is a common reason for treatment abandonment.
The common risk factor approach matters because it prevents fragmented advice. Diet, tobacco, alcohol, stress and hygiene influence caries, periodontal disease, oral cancer, obesity, diabetes and cardiovascular disease together, so the dental team's smoking and alcohol advice is part of a wider public health effort rather than a dental add-on. This is the reasoning behind very brief advice on smoking at every recall and alcohol screening where indicated, and it is why these are considered core general dental practice in the UK rather than optional extras.
